Kerala rain brings bountiful flow to Kabini dam

Bengaluru, Sept 19: Heavy rain in Wayanad district of Kerala has substantially increased the inflow to the Kabini reservoir in HD Kote taluk, Mysuru district.

With only two feet left for the Kabini reservoir to reach its maximum level, farmers of the region are a happy lot. While the maximum water level of the dam is 2,284 ft, it stood at 2281.50 ft on Monday.

The inflow to the dam has increased to 16,500 cusecs. The dam is expected to reach the brim soon. The outflow is 15,000 cusecs.

Kabini reservoir executive engineer Jagadish told DH that the capacity of the dam was 19.5 tmc ft and the current storage was 17.5 tmc ft. The dam is expected to reach the maximum level in the next two days, he said.

Heavy showers lashed across Kodagu district on Monday. Virajpet, Gonikoppa, Perumbadi, Kutta, Makutta and Srimangala experienced bountiful rain. As a result, rivers and rivulets are getting copious flow.

Holiday was declared for schools and colleges in Virajpet taluk. Napoklu, Chattimani, Bhagamandala and Talacauvery experienced intermittent rain. The devotees who had come for the Pushkara snana (holy dip) in River Cauvery faced inconvenience. In the last 24 hours (ending 8.30 am on Monday), Madikeri received 79.4 mm, Virajpet 104.4 mm, Bhagamandala 71 mm rainfall. The inflow of water to Harangi reservoir has increased to 3,595 cusecs.

Heavy rain lashed the Malnad region of Shivamogga district intermittently on Monday. Hosanagar and Thirthahalli received heavy rain intermittently since morning. Shivamogga, Bhadravathi and other parts of the district received moderate rain.

Mangaluru, Jul 2: A frontline covid-19 warrior who was working in the Wenlock Covid hospital in the city has been tested positive for the coronavirus. 

Sources said that he was a pathologist working in covid testing laboratory of the Wenlock Covid hospital.

A few days ago, a senior health official had tested positive for the covid-19.

Dakshina Kannada has so far recorded deaths of 18 covid-19 patients. A total of 14,137 samples have been tested, out of which 13,040 have turned out negative, and 833 positive, including 10 persons from other districts. 372 cases are currently active.

Mangaluru, Jun 3: The district administrations of Dakshina Kannada and Kasaragod have issued standard operating procedures (SOP) for the movement of people between two neighbouring districts that fall under two different states.

Even though thousands of people used to commute between these two districts due to employment, education and other reasons every day, the travel has been banned for over two months due to covid lockdown.

Dakshina Kannada DC Sindhu B Rupesh has assured that travel passes will be issued for working professionals/students who have to commute every day.

Those who wish to travel to DK district from Kasargod have to register on https://bit.ly/dkdpermit for daily pass.

The pass applicant should mention the travel destinations, and the complete work address in DK. He/she should also upload Aadhaar card, proof of workplace. On receipt of the applications, the AC of Mangaluru division will issue the pass which will be valid till June 30.

The DC said that the pass details will be recorded at Talapady check post daily. Those who fail to report during the exit from Dakshina Kannada will be subjected to quarantine by the taluk administration and penal action will be initiated as per Epidemic Act, she warned.

Thermal screening of all persons entering DK will be conducted at the checkpost. Only those who are asymptomatic will be allowed to enter.

As per the SOP issued by Kasargod District Collector, those who wish to commute between these two districts have to register in COVID-19 Jagratha portal under the emergency pass category and the applicant has to mention the reason as “inter-state travel on a daily basis."

Bengaluru, Jul 28: As many as 5,536 new COVID-19 cases and 102 deaths were reported in Karnataka on Tuesday, according to the State Health Department.

With these new cases of coronavirus, the total number of positive cases in the state stands at 1,07,001 including 64,434 active cases, 40,504 discharges and 2,055 deaths.

India on Tuesday reported 47,704 more COVID-19 cases in the last 24 hours, taking the country's count of coronavirus cases to 14,83,157, informed the Union Ministry of Health and Family Welfare.

Out of the total cases, there are 4,96,988 active cases in the country while the number of patients cured/discharged and migrated stands at 9,52,744. With 654 deaths due to COVID-19 in the country reported in the last 24 hours, the death toll rises to 33,425.
